March 31, 2015 by John Halas
Apparently, we weren't the only ones to notice the exterior styling similarities between Lincoln's new Continental Concept and the Bentley Flying Spur; so did Bentley's Chief Designer Luc Donckerwolke and he wasn't happy…

"I would have called it Flying Spur concept and kept the four round lights," Donckerwolke sardonically wrote on his Facebook page, according to Road&Track. "I thought this was only done in China? Finally a 'Bentley for the masses' though," responded another designer in the comments.

Donckerwolke didn’t stop there, as he reportedly posted a sarcastic question on Lincoln Design Director David Woodhouse's Facebook page, though it was promptly removed: "Do you want us to send the product tooling?"

Bentley's design boss was far from done, as he spoke to Car Design News: "This behavior is not respectable. Building a copy like this is giving a bad name to the car design world."

The British brand's exterior design chief, Sangyup Lee, agreed describing the Lincoln as "a joke," and adding, "It is very disappointing, especially for an exclusive brand like Lincoln."
